Transaction 688b87901e28d1419362a59f34a8aa13067d14c8b34d63bb23e50dc4feedb329
1 Input
1 Output
-
688b87901e28d1419362a59f34a8aa13067d14c8b34d63bb23e50dc4feedb329:0
- value
- 97713
- script pubkey
- OP_0 OP_PUSHBYTES_32 5c2dc050d021af9db194296acba6a19e648ae6027b5388445782494cea07aa03
- address
- bc1qtskuq5xsyxhemvv5994vhf4pnejg4esz0dfcs3zhsfy5e6s84gps2w9ytn